  cu8sfan: If you want you may participate in <cu8sfan's Tournament Prediction Game on Chessgames.com>.

Rules:
1. Every kibitzer can make one prediction for the outcome of individual games of a tournament round that is in the cTPGoC.c. Predictions for future rounds are allowed. Predictions can usually be posted until the start of the games. If you post more than once for the same round the last post is valid.

2. Over the course of a tournament new participants can only enter the competition during the first three games of the tournament.

3. Predictions have to be posted on the cu8sfan chessforum. This is also where I will post seasonal standings and other information on the contest.

4. For every outcome predicted right a participant will get one point.

5. The winner of a tournament is the one who gets the most points in that tournament. If two players have the same score the one who has the better average per round will win the tournament.

6. Seasonal points will be calculated by the formula devised by fellow kibitzer <firebyrd>: Award accumulated points for being: - top 50%
- top 30%
- top 20%
- top 10%
- winner
- single winner
The percentages are taken from the number of participants that have played in more than one round. The numbers are rounded to the next higher integer.

7. I am not without fault. Errors in my calculations can be e-mailed or posted on the cu8sfan chessforum

8. I get to decide which tournaments will be in the cTPGoC.c and which ones won't.

9. I am running this tournament on my own. If you don't like it, fine. If you do, please participate and have fun.
